Stuart Taylor, 45, from Lancing, West Sussex, is set to run the London Marathon on April 27, 2025, while singing karaoke to raise money for WaterAid.
Stuart, who has been singing along to his tunes during his runs, will belt out songs ranging from 80s rock to 90s R&B, and will finish with Frank Sinatra's My Way.
He’s already raised over £3,500 of his £4,000 target, and plans to encourage others to join in with his karaoke setup.
Stuart has supported WaterAid through various challenges in the past and aims to highlight the importance of clean water and sanitation.
